Water contamination isn’t the only reason so many homeowners switch to filtered water. Many areas have hard water. This is especially true when water is drawn from wells. Hard water is mineral rich. These minerals are deposited on skin, hair, and cause clogging buildup in any appliances it runs through.

Types of Water Filters We Can Install:

  • At the source water filtration: Filtering water as it comes into the home is the best method for homeowners who want filtered water for showering and washing.
  • At the tap water filtration: If safer drinking water is your primary concern, at the tap options can be a more cost-effective measure to protect your health.

Other Reasons to Install a Water Filtration System:

  • Protect your appliances and save money on electricity. Block a third of your faucet spout with your thumb. Does it seem less efficient? That’s happening in every tube and appliance that hard water runs through. Our filtration systems stop hard water and save your plumbing system.
  • Whole home water filtration that’s good for your body. Hard water is hard on your skin, hair, and nails, too. We also offer water softener systems that integrate with your filtration system. These greatly reduce magnesium and calcium ions, helping your body to be its best inside and out.
